#644887 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#644887 is composed of 39.2% red, 28.2%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.9% cyan, 46.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 266.7 degrees, a saturation of 30.4% and a lightness of 40.6%. #644887 color hex could be obtained by blending #c890ff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#644887 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#644887 has RGB values of R:100, G:72, B:135 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 6572167.

Shades and Tints of #644887
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050407 is the darkest color, while #faf9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#644887
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#67606f is the less saturated color, while #5c00cf is the most saturated one.
